Its marketing. Depending on fit, the conventional barrel may shoot better groups.

CJB
07-01-2016, 05:12 AM
Follow up...

In an autoloader, the outside fit of the barrel is the key to accuracy. For example, old military 1911 barrels, welded up and recut to fit tight, shoot as good as any. The limit is the mechanics of the platform not the rifling.

yes you can swap out the barrels if you want. At 140 bux you may want to ask yourself if you're willing to spend that much. Those polygonal barrels are very nice and they are easier to clean over the conventional rifling barrels.
if it was me, I'd spend the xtra dough & replace the front sight with a metal trijicon night sight from kahr's shop, maybe a milled slide stop pin and replace that MIM one.

Funny, I have the PM 9 with polygonal rifling and want the other conventional barrel. Since I reload my own and sometimes use lead, or rather moly coated lead or Hi-Tek coated lead it is acceptable in conventional barrels but not in Glock type polygonal. Hence in my Glock I have a match grade Lone Wolf barrel.
So the reason I am here in this thread is that I am considering the next purchase which would be either a CM or CW45 which has the conventional rather than the PM.
